This shared hall bath has a vintage flair with a beautiful eclectic glass chandelier. The floor tile is 2" octagon white carrara marble with an inlay basket weave white carrara border. The wall tile a matching 2"x3" subway white carrara style porcelain tile. Clawfoot tub with telephone style faucet and low threshold walk-in shower with sliding barn doors give multiple bathing options. The room is completed with a console style sink and opaque barn door to keep the room feeling larger than a medium sized hall bath should. Small details like the bead board ceiling and the arabesque tile in the shower niche round out this fabulous hall bath makeover.

This 1,000ft² recording and production studio, built in 2021 for producer couple Latifah Alattas and Lucas Morton, was designed as a fully custom creative environment that supports writing, mixing, and collaboration at the highest level. Both Latifah and Lucas are multi-instrumentalists, engineers, and mixers, and the studio reflects the full range of their workflows—visually inspiring, technically precise, and intuitive in every room.
The facility was built from the ground up with a strong emphasis on architectural acoustics and plug-and-play connectivity. The layout includes two Control Rooms, multiple isolation booths, and shared common spaces, all tied together with seamless audio integration. No matter where you are in the studio, routing, monitoring, and communication remain effortless and consistent.
Behind the aesthetic, the acoustic design is exceptionally robust. Six independent floating-floor systems support the suites, ensuring each room operates with minimal sound transmission. Tailored sound-reducing wall assemblies, full-lite doors, engineered window systems, and intentional treatment plans deliver clarity, isolation, and precision for tracking and mixing. Each space is mechanically decoupled, allowing multiple rooms to run simultaneously without compromise.
For monitoring, both Latifah and Lucas chose Genelec “The Ones” series monitors with GLM calibration to ensure accurate translation and consistency across the entire facility.
Natural light and a warm, welcoming aesthetic anchor the visual identity of the studio, reflecting the creative energy and personality of its owners. The result is a highly functional, beautifully crafted space where ideas can move freely and production can happen without limitations.

London apartments are often known for their unique entrances. From grand lobbies with high ceilings to quaint doorways tucked away on quiet streets, there's no shortage of variety when it comes to apartment entrances in the city.
One of the most common types of entrances in London apartments is the communal entrance, which is typically located on the ground floor of a building and shared by multiple tenants. These entrances often feature intercom systems or key fobs for added security, and may also have mailboxes or a concierge desk.
For those who prefer a more private entrance, there are also many apartments in London with their own separate entrances. These can range from discreet doorways on side streets to grand entrances with steps leading up to the front door.
Regardless of the type of entrance, London apartments often have a certain charm and character that makes them stand out. Whether you're looking for a modern apartment with sleek lines or a classic Victorian townhouse with ornate details, there's something for everyone in London's apartment market.
